The defense of the New York Giants is primed to be a productive defense in Week 4 versus the Chicago Bears. Entering Sunday's contest, the Giants boast the No. 25 ranked pass DVOA defense and the No. 28 ranked rush DVOA defense. Despite the struggles that New York's defense has had to begin the season, they'll have a premier matchup against Chicago's anemic offense in Week 4. Justin Field has only attempted 45 passes for the Bears in the first three weeks and he's still managed to be sacked 10 times this season.
